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best places to kayak near Mc Farland, WI?

Top picks near Mc Farland include Law Park, Babcock County Park, Riley-Deppe County Park. In total there are 30 public launch points within 50 miles, with paddling on lakes, rivers.

What types of paddling can I do near Mc Farland?

Near Mc Farland you'll find opportunities for kayaking, canoeing, and stand-up paddle boarding. Most locations offer beginner-friendly conditions with public boat ramp access.

Are there free kayak launches near Mc Farland?

Yes! Most public boat ramps near Mc Farland are free to use. Some state parks and recreation areas may charge a small parking or entrance fee.
